Improving radiotherapy safety and efficiency with the customized ARIA oncology information system

OBJECTIVE:To improve safety and efficiency of radiotherapy process by customizing a Varian ARIA oncology information system following the guidelines provided in AAPM TG-100 report. METHODS:First, failure mode and effects analysis (FMEA) and quality management program were implemented for radiotherapy process. We have customized the visual care path in the ARIA system and set up a series of templates for simulation, prescription, contouring, treatment planning, and multiple checklists. Average time of activities’ completion and amount of planning errors were compared before and after the use of the customized ARIA to evaluate its impact on the efficiency and safety of radiotherapy. RESULTS:Completion time and on-time completion rate of the key activities in the care path are improved. The time of OAR/targets contouring decreases from (1.94±1.51) days to (1.64±1.07) days (p = 0.003), with the on-time completion rate increases from 77.4%to 83.3%(p = 0.048). Treatment planning time decreases from (0.81±0.65) days to (0.55±0.51) days (p < 0.001), with the on-time completion rate increases from 96.6%to 98.3%(p = 0.163). Waiting time of patients decreases from (4.50±1.83) days to (4.04±1.34) days (p < 0.001), with the on-time completion rate increases from 81.9%to 89.7%(p = 0.003). In addition, the average plan error rate decreases from 5.5%(2.9%for safety errors and 2.6%for non-normative errors) to 2.4%(1.6%for safety errors and 0.8%for non-normative errors) (p = 0.029). CONCLUSION:Our study demonstrates that the customized ARIA system has the potential to promote efficiency and safety in radiotherapy process management. It is beneficial to organize and accelerate the treatment process with more effective communications and fewer errors.

使用定制的 ARIA 肿瘤学信息系统提高放射治疗的安全性和效率

目的:按照 AAPM TG-100 报告中提供的指南,通过定制 Varian ARIA 肿瘤学信息系统来提高放射治疗过程的安全性和效率。方法:首先,对放疗过程实施失效模式和影响分析(FMEA)和质量管理程序。我们在 ARIA 系统中定制了视觉护理路径,并设置了一系列用于模拟、处方、轮廓、治疗计划和多个检查表的模板。比较了使用定制 ARIA 前后活动完成的平均时间和计划错误的数量,以评估其对放射治疗效率和安全性的影响。结果:护理路径中关键活动的完成时间和按时完成率都有所提高。OAR/目标轮廓的时间从(1.94±1. 51)天到(1.64±1.07)天(p = 0.003),准时完成率从77.4%增加到83.3%(p = 0.048)。治疗计划时间从(0.81±0.65)天减少到(0.55±0.51)天(p < 0.001),按时完成率从96.6%提高到98.3%(p = 0.163)。患者候诊时间从(4.50±1.83)天减少到(4.04±1.34)天(p < 0.001),按时完成率从81.9%提高到89.7%(p = 0.003)。此外,平均计划错误率从 5.5%(安全错误为 2.9%,非规范错误为 2.6%)降至 2.4%(安全错误为 1.6%,非规范错误为 0.8%)(p = 0.029) . 结论:我们的研究表明,定制的 ARIA 系统具有提高放射治疗过程管理效率和安全性的潜力。
